"Ireland Cheats the US" –Trump Slams Ireland’s Trade Tactics In St. Patrick’s Day Meet | Watch
Ireland cheats the US—that's what Donald Trump claimed during his St. Patrick’s Day meeting with Irish PM Micheál Martin at the White House. Trump accused Ireland of taking advantage of the US by attracting pharmaceutical companies with tax policies. Martin countered, highlighting Ireland’s economic contributions to the US.
